You math is fine and focal is good, I would not go with sony for a head unit or anything else ever sense there "xplod" line. I would also just not pair them with Jl stuff. I would for a serious install look at Hertz, audioson, zapco, and rainbow. Also focal has different models for how much you want to spend. If you want higher end focals your going to have to spend more. Also do not forget install and labor.
However getting back to the subject at hand you should always run new wires with new speakers. And run a new amp and processor with a bose system to get the best sound out of your new speakers.
